Dental implants have revolutionized restorative dentistry, offering a durable resolution for individuals with missing teeth. One of the most exceptional elements of this process is how dental implants combine with the jawbone, a course of often known as osseointegration. This phenomenon just isn't solely crucial for the soundness of the implant but additionally for the this article long-term success of the restorative dental work.

The major part of a dental implant is a titanium submit, which is surgically inserted into the jawbone. Titanium is chosen for its biocompatibility, allowing it to coexist with the human body without provoking an immune response. Once placed, the submit serves as a synthetic tooth root, providing the mandatory assist for a crown or bridge.


After the implant is inserted, a process of therapeutic begins. This healing phase can vary in duration however typically takes a number of months. The jawbone surrounding the implant undergoes a transformation, responding to the presence of the titanium submit. The bone cells begin emigrate toward the implant, a crucial step that allows for the institution of a stable bond between the bone and the implant.


As the therapeutic progresses, the bone begins to grow and transform across the implant. This process is influenced by the mechanical load the implant will bear as soon as a restoration is positioned. The extra stress an implant endures, the higher the preliminary integration, as the physique adapts to the model new implant by reinforcing the bone structure. This is why correct placement throughout surgery is essential; it must account for both the aesthetic and functional requirements.

Bone quality is also an important factor in determining how effectively the implant integrates. Patients with denser, more healthy bone will typically experience a quicker and more practical osseointegration. Conversely, these with compromised bone quality might require bone grafting procedures before or in the course of the implant surgery, allowing for higher integration in a while.


Several methods, such as sinus lifts or ridge augmentations, can improve bone density and floor area for implant integration. Surgeons rigorously evaluate every patient’s bone structure and general oral health before deciding on the best plan of action. These preemptive measures are vital in making certain long-term success, lowering the likelihood of implant failure.


The dental implant process is typically a multi-step course of. After the preliminary placement of the implant and the subsequent therapeutic interval, a post—known as an abutment—is connected to the implant. This abutment connects the implant to the bogus tooth. It is essential that this connection is stable, as it bears the every day stresses that come with chewing and biting.

Once the abutment is in place, the ultimate prosthetic—a crown, bridge, or denture—can be affixed. It’s throughout this period that the implant’s performance throughout the mouth is absolutely realized. The integration of the implant with the jawbone provides a degree of stability and help much like that of natural teeth, enabling people to regain their confidence and enhance their quality of life.


Regular dental check-ups are important after receiving implants, as they offer ongoing assessments of the implant's integrity. The dentist will monitor the health of the surrounding gum tissue and the stability of the implant. Any signs of infection, inflammation, or bone loss must be addressed promptly to prevent complications.


Overall health elements additionally play a vital function within the success of dental implants. Patients with conditions similar to diabetes or autoimmune diseases may face challenges within the healing course of (Dental Implant Dentures Holland MI). It’s essential for potential implant recipients to disclose their full medical histories to their dental professionals


It’s worth noting that the success of dental implants traditionally ranges around 90 to ninety five %. This high success rate is basically due to the innovative know-how and strategies used in implant dentistry today. Research into dental supplies and strategies continues to evolve, making it potential to attain superior integration outcomes for all kinds of sufferers.

By changing missing teeth with dental implants, sufferers not only restore functionality but additionally promote oral health. The presence of an implant stimulates the jawbone, preventing the bone loss that usually occurs when teeth are missing. This stimulation encourages the retention of facial structure and appearance, additional enhancing the general advantages of the process.


In conclusion, the seamless integration of dental implants with the jawbone represents a significant development in dental restoration methods. The means of osseointegration ensures that the implants remain steady and functional for years, allowing people to take pleasure in a full range of movement and aesthetics that natural teeth provide. With cautious planning, surgical experience, and ongoing maintenance, dental implants can transform not just smiles however lives.

Dental implants are sometimes made from titanium or zirconia, supplies recognized for his or her biocompatibility. This means they will fuse with bone tissue, a process referred to as osseointegration, which helps present a steady basis for replacement teeth.

What factors have an effect on how well dental implants integrate with the jawbone?


Several elements affect integration success, including the density and health of the jawbone, the kind of implant used, oral hygiene practices, and overall health conditions like diabetes. Proper evaluation and remedy planning are crucial for successful outcomes.

Can smoking influence the mixing of dental implants with the jawbone?

Yes, smoking can significantly hinder the osseointegration course of. It restricts blood move and slows therapeutic, which can enhance the danger of implant failure. Quitting smoking earlier than and after the procedure is extremely beneficial for higher outcomes.


What happens if the dental implant doesn't combine with the jawbone?

If an implant fails to integrate, it might loosen or turn into infected. In such cases, the implant may must be eliminated, and sufferers can focus on choices for bone grafting or alternative remedies with their dentist.


Is there a method to enhance the integration of dental implants with the jawbone?




Yes, varied methods can enhance integration, such as utilizing a bone graft, adopting superior surgical techniques, or using development issue therapies. Regular monitoring and following the dentist's post-operative care instructions also play an important function in profitable integration.
